Output 677479969e006f3e91e691d89d77203d72b33407d78d2108f6cb8d7441286221:0

value
26283619
script pubkey
OP_HASH160 OP_PUSHBYTES_20 963f05e8071dd9e9036cf0dfb6a7ee7a6e62d0e9 OP_EQUAL
address
MMbb68BD9FueLD7vMt9GcjgStALybZg3ht
transaction
677479969e006f3e91e691d89d77203d72b33407d78d2108f6cb8d7441286221
spent
true